Shay Jackson
Shay
Jackson
6'0" | PG
Totino-Grace | 2027
State
MN
played one of the best floor games I have seen all season when he led Select over North Dakota Phenom on Saturday. This was a near 20 point game and Shay sliced and diced the Phenom with attacks, with his push, with his pace, the making of open shots, but more importantly, he had full control of the offense and the team flourished because of it.
This might be the first time I have seen Shay with the ball in his hands nearly the entire game to run the show and the impression made was lasting. CSP and SJU are on Shay heavy and I can see why…. he got an A+ plus for his decision making and an A++ as a top ball pressure guy. With ball in Shay’s hands fully, Select played their best game since April (that I have seen).

Shay Jackson
Shay
Jackson
6'0" | PG
Totino-Grace | 2027
State
MN
just keeps getting better this spring/summer. Against a North Dakota Phenom team that featured some of the top 2027’s in North Dakota, Shay was coming up with plays to help lead his Select team to a comfortable win. The opposing defense just didn’t have anyone that could handle the quickness of Shay on the ball, and he was able to get to his spots for a couple of pull-up jumpers throughout the game. Shay is extremely dangerous out in the open floor because he’s constantly scanning, and times his passes perfectly to find a teammate slashing to the rim. Defensively he showed that on-ball pressure that tends to force a handful of turnovers just about every time he steps on the floor.
